DeLonghi DCF210TTC Coffeemaker with Thermal Carafe Review



DeLonghi DCF210TTC Complete Frontal Access 10-Cup Drip Coffeemaker with Thermal Carafe Technical Review

* 10-cup drip coffeemaker with thermal carafe and a 24-hour programmable digital timer
* Fill the machine out of the closet, patented front drawer provides easy access to canal water and coffee basket
* Aroma Button: This special feature option, timed releases of water saturating coffee grounds a little at a time in a more full flavor extract, the result is an improved taste and aroma to those who prefer a full cup of coffee.
* Passive cup warmer on top, nonstick coatings hot plate, two-hour auto-off, cord storage
* Permanent gold-tone filter water level indicator Pause and serve function
